Python parse Tornado query string params and provide default values.clientparams self.request.queryarguments. for i in clientparams.keys(): clientparams[i] clientparams[i].decode(). Now we can install the requests library and make a Python file for the scraper.page: page . Making the post request. response requests.post(self.APIurl, datadata) . The data that we are looking is in the second . processquerystring(self) Parse the query string into Python structures.querystring The query component of the Request-URI, a string of information to be interpreted by the resource. ditto, takes query string from default locations. a shelf is a (g)dbm files that stores pickled Python objects. import shelve. class UserDatareq self.ui.req or home mname dos req try: meth getattr( self, mname) except AttributeError: self.
error("Bad request type s." req) else Laravel one to many relation delete request with guzzle.property def tois(self): return self / Top of Information Store.a new list [duplicate] ax.hist not outputting the same as np.histogram Extract Relationships from sql queries nltk Python 3 Save buttons Converting code from Python 2.6.5 to Python version. Usage. Examples.
comsubmit-buttonSubscribe HTTP/1.1. Request tells the server what to run. querys parsedpath.query, requestversions self.requestversion, , SERVER VALUESThen start the server: python BaseHTTPServerGET.py Starting server, use to stop. In a separate terminal, use curl to access it data urllib.request.urlopen(req).read() . For Python 3 use this: except urllib.error.HTTPError as edef request(self, path, argsNone, postargsNone): """ Fetches the given path in the Graph API. We translate args to a valid query string. QUERYSTRING The query string, as a single (unparsed) string.def processrequest(self, request): """ Rewrites the proxy headers so that only the most.QueryDict.getlist(key, default). Returns the data with the requested key, as a Python list. QUERYSTRING: age10hobbiessoftwarehobbiestunning REQUESTMETHOD: GET.!/usr/bin/env python. from wsgiref.simpleserver import makeserver from cgi import parseqs, escape. Project: pepipost-sdk-python Author: pepipost File: RequestsClient.py View Source Project. 6 votes. def executeasstring( self, request)self.dssquerystrforsignature None. params (dict) Parameters to be sent in the query string of the new request (optional).class SiteHandler: async def index(self, request): return web.Response(textHello Aiohttp!)required version is Python 3.4.1 541 Add async with support for ClientSession.request() and family 536 Begin serving a GET request""" . build self.body from the query string.def runtpl(self,script): """ Templating system with the string substitution syntax. introduced in Python 2.4""" . values must be strings, not lists. Returns the value of the argument with the given name from the request query string.It is up to the request handler to call self.finish() to finish the HTTP request.Use Pythons format string syntax to customize how values are substituted. You should set the flag explicitly if you would like threads to behave autonomously the default is False, meaning that Python will not exit until all threads created by ThreadingMixInFor stream services, self.request is a socket object for datagram services, self.request is a pair of string and socket. ispy self.ispython(scriptname). if not ispyenv[SERVERPORT] str(self.server.serverport). env[REQUESTMETHOD] self.command.for k in (QUERYSTRING, REMOTEHOST, CONTENTLENGTH Python Web Development. Requests is a Python module that you can use to send all kinds of HTTP requests.You can provide these query strings as a dictionary of strings using the params keyword in the GET request. Python Tutorial. CGI Web. query. def broadcaststring( self, str, omitsock ): for sock in self.descriptors: if sock ! self.srvsock and sock ! omitsockThe Web protocol is request/response in nature over stream sockets. Python makes it easy to build Web robots through a simple Web interface. The SocketServer module has been renamed to socketserver in Python 3.0. The 2to3 tool will automatically adapt imports when converting your sources to 3.0.For stream services, self.request is a socket object for datagram services, self.request is a pair of string and socket. The test client is a Python class that acts as a dummy Web browser, allowing you to test your viewsThe extra keyword arguments parameter can be used to specify headers to be sent in the request.response self.client.get(/) . For each action, you can supply either a list of values or a string. utils.authenticate def query(self, querystring)return utils.sendrequest(method, self.httplib def handleconnect(self): connection succeeded self.send(self.request). 7-15. Python Standard Library: Network Protocols.query os.environ.get("QUERYSTRING") if not query Heres the equivalent Python dictionary. Well convert this dict into a JSON string when we send our requests.import json import requests from bs4 import BeautifulSoup. class AppleJobsScraper(object): def init( self): self.searchrequest . [docs] def isvalid(self, requestdata, requestidNone): """ Constructs the response object. : param requestid: Optional argument. The ID of the AuthNRequest sent by this SP to the IdP : type requestid: string class TestHttpServer(BaseHTTPRequestHandler): def doPOST(self): Process request. pip install jsonrpcclient[requests] python. self.request.GET is provided by the webapp2 framework through the class in which get() is implemented. It provides your code with access to a dictionary containing any query string parameters that were sent with the Email codedump link for Understanding request parameters in python. server.py, this python file creates a basic web server that can respond to GET and POST requests. It uses BaseHTTPServer for the web server, urlparse to get the GET request parameters, and cgi for gettingclass GP(BaseHTTPRequestHandler): def setheaders(self): self .sendresponse(200).this script, as run by Apache2: !/usr/bin/python print self.request. querystring prints nothing, and at the command line, the same produces this erroris not defined How do I read the querystring? First of all, the self keyword is only available once defined in a function, typically an objects. You can make Query string using GET parameters like this. Request.GET.urlencode(). This does not include the ? prefix, and it may not return the keys in the same order as in the original request. if isinstance(query, str): query query.encode(utf-8).Python 2s json.dumps . provides this natively, but Python 3 gives a Unicode string.is a response. self.request None. actually a query-string composed by oauthtoken and oauthtokensecret, python-social-auth expects this to be a dict with those keys, but if an string is detected, it will treat it as a query string in the form oauthtoken123class CustomFacebookOAuth2(FacebookOauth2): def getscope(self) This can include a query string, separated from the main part of the URI by a "?".It has the form product/version. The default is Python/2.5.1. self.errormessageformat.self.requestversion. The protocol version string sent by the browser. Generally it will be HTTP/1.0 or HTTP/1.1. If you havent checked out kennethreitzs excellent python-requests library yet, I suggest you go do that immediately. Go on, Ill wait for you.And heres what the signature of the constructor for Session objects looks like. def init( self, headersNone, cookiesNone, authNone, timeoutNone Strings in Python. Common info about strings. string is the most suitable data type for human.s5 This is a multi line string! query """ SELECT. id, name, age FROM. users WHERE.return string for user s self.id. The following are 18 code examples for showing how to use flask.request. querystring(). They are extracted from open source Python projects. You can vote up the examples you like or vote down the exmaples you dont like. Tags: python forms routes pyramid deform.Note here the query string "actionedit". the configuration consists of datafile, templates etc.action getattr(self.request.GET, action) except AttributeError